Position DutiesA Police Recruit is an entry level position and applies to someone who does NOT have police/peace officer or training within the State of California; police officers from other states and federal law enforcement officers who do NOT possess a California P.O.S.T. Academy Certificate; and someone who has graduated from a California P.O.S.T. Academy but has NOT completed a patrol field training program.
The San Jose Police Department does not accept the California P.O.S.T. Waiver.
- Written exams:
Candidates must pass one of the following:- California P.O.S.T. Reading & Writing Test (PELLETB). Pass point is a T‑Score total of 50 or higher. Results valid for three years. Register here.
- National Testing Network (NTN) Frontline Written Exam. Pass point scores are 60% Video, 65% Reading, and 65% Writing. Results valid for three years. Register here.
- Physical agility exam:
Candidates must pass a physical agility examination valid for one year. The California P.O.S.T. Physical Agility Test (WSTB) includes a 99‑yard obstacle course, 32‑foot body drag, six‑foot chain‑link fence climb with 25‑yard sprint, a 500‑yard run, a 1.5‑mile run (must finish in 14 minutes or less). Register here. The WSTB from other departments is not accepted.
- At least 20‑½ years old at the time of application; maximum age is 70 years old (mandatory retirement age).
- Legally authorized to work in the United States under Federal Law.
- Possession of a valid driver’s license authorizing operation of a motor vehicle in the U.S.
- Must possess at the time of application a U.S. high school diploma or GED; waived if you have earned a college degree from an accredited college within the U.S.
